Description
We are seeking a highly skilled QA Tester to join our team. The ideal candidate should have 2-7 years of experience in software testing, with a strong background in manual and automated testing methodologies. The candidate should be familiar with industry-standard tools and technologies used in software testing. The candidate should also have excellent analytical skills, attention to detail, and the ability to work independently and in a team environment.
Responsibilities
- Develop and execute test cases, scripts, plans, and procedures based on software requirements and design documents.
- Identify, track, and report defects and issues in a timely manner.
- Collaborate with software developers, project managers, and other stakeholders to ensure quality software development.
- Participate in the design and development of software testing frameworks, tools, and methodologies.
- Conduct both manual and automated testing of software applications.
- Perform regression testing, performance testing, and other types of testing as required.
- Contribute to the continuous improvement of the software development process and testing methodologies.
Skills and Qualifications
- 2-7 years of experience in software testing.
- Bachelor's or Master's degree in Computer Science or a related field.
- Strong knowledge of manual and automated testing methodologies.
- Experience with industry-standard testing tools such as Selenium, JMeter, and TestNG.
- Familiarity with Agile and Waterfall software development methodologies.
- Experience working with software development teams in an Agile environment.
- Excellent analytical skills and attention to detail.
- Strong written and verbal communication skills.
- Ability to work independently and in a team environment.